Abstract

A method and apparatus are provided for on-device positioning using compressed fingerprint archives. The method and apparatus may be configured to provide compression of localization fingerprints, to facilitate efficient on-device positioning based on the RF fingerprint model, and to estimate the physical distance between two or more devices. Embodiments of the method may receive a space-to-access point histogram that corresponds to an access point as observed in a space. A mean, standard deviation, and weight may be calculated and assigned for each of a plurality of access points as observed within a space. The mean, standard deviation, and weight of each access point may be combined to form a data triple. The data triples may be combined to form a fingerprint of access points observed from that space. The data triple or plurality of data triples with the lowest assigned weight(s) may be removed from the fingerprint.

Claims (22)

1. A method comprising:

determining the access points of a first fingerprint;

determining the access points of a second fingerprint;

calculating a similarity in signal strengths of access points that are common to both the first fingerprint and the second fingerprint;

determining access points that are exclusive to each of the first fingerprint and the second fingerprint; and

calculating a distance metric between the first fingerprint and the second fingerprint by using the similarity in the signal strengths of access points that are common to the first fingerprint and the second fingerprint to indicate proximate distances, and exclusive access points to indicate distant distances.
